6:30 to 8 p.m. June 19, Jim Parsley Center, 2901 Falk Rd. Free. Hear historian Pat Jollota, archaeologist Elaine Dorset and grower Kelly Baur talk about Clark County's agricultural past and how it ties into our current agricultural economy. After the panel discussion, local food activist Justine Hanrahan will show us her new documentary, "History of Agriculture in Clark County." View the film trailer:
